After 33 years of thrilling rides, Silver Dollar City is preparing to retire its iconic Thunderation roller coaster. The Branson theme park announced that the 2026 season will be the last for the runaway mine train-style coaster, marking th...
Thunderation, the runaway mile train coaster, debuted in 1993 and quickly became one of Silver Dollar City's most popular attractions. Designed by Arrow Dynamics, the coaster spans 3,022 feet of track and reaches speeds of 48 mph. Over its 33 years, it has provided thrills for over 27 million riders.
The decision to retire Thunderation comes as the Marvel Cave Mining Company seeks to resume mining operations in the area. According to park officials, geological surveys will be conducted in the coaster's place, paving the way for new attractions and developments within Silver Dollar City. The park plans to honor Thunderation with a year-long celebration in 2026, featuring special ride moments, promotional offers, and commemorative merchandise. This celebration will allow fans to experience the coaster one last time and say goodbye to a beloved piece of Silver Dollar City history.
